The lost soul
I never knew what to make of it -
It slid and slithered
In and out
Of my life.
Those moments
When I felt my soul connect
With another
And melt down the neglect.
Those words
That truly brought
Those smiles to my eyes
And caused my stomach knot.
Just a look
Cured the pain
And bore me down
Never ever in vain.
But why do I feel
Loss and sorrow—
More than my mind
Can ever borrow…
But why is it that
I am scared to care—
For you and for me
Not I dare…
But why do I think
Of all the wounds—
This is the one
I will ever be bound…
Why Anam Cara?
Why?
Despite all your versions,
You have always been
My curse and prison…
You did show though —
Even being a beast
Life is but a beauty!
